    I have only had my fitbit charge for 2 days but I am in love! For me, it was worth the extra money because with two taps of my finger I have a watch on my wrist all of the time!

    I wasn't worried about the Flex being colour changeable for fashion purposes so discounted that as a reason to go with it. I also discounted the charge HR as frankly I don't need to know my heart rate as I don't do anything more energetic than walking to work and back.

    The flex shows you how close you are to your personal target (you can amend it from steps, to calories burned, to floors climbed, whatever you want to focus on and you can also obviously change those goals i.e. from 10k steps to 15k... It doesn't have a digital display, just 5 lights across the front. These also tell you how charged it is etc. It is quite simple but makes the app all the more necessary to view your stats in facts and figures.

    The charge shows you the stats on the app too, but there is a button on the side which clicks through in order, Time, Steps, Distance, Calories Burned, Floors climbed, and for me it also shows me when my next alarm is set to go off. Monday at 7am just so you know ;) It also vibrates when you receive a phone call, and when you hit your target!!

    Best of all it tracks your sleep! None of them are any more waterproof than the others particularly. Only good for showers and splashing, not the shower/swimming etc.

    The basic premise for ketogenic is to eat a predominantly (75%) FAT based diet, with less than 5% carbs (which are even in vegetables, especially carrot, sweetcorn & peas) and the remainder protein. The website I linked there has a shedload of research which I used to work out how much protein based on my body weight/height I should be eating. The first week is hard, but if you get through the sugar cravings and headaches (salt and water) then you suddenly get this rush of energy and it works wonders for morale. I am doing well!!

    It takes 6 weeks for it to start working on migraines and my Doctor basically said it is great for epilepsy (which my migraines are a relic of) and migraines. The reason for this as far as science can work out is that carbohydrates cause raised blood sugars and insulin to bring this down. This causes instability in the brain and stress which provokes the migraines. By turning your body into a machine that burns fat for fuel and keeping your insulin levels barely there, you are reducing the stress until your brain functions much better and the migraines stop.
